`coin-build-tools` provides a set of tools to build [Coin-OR] libraries from source.

## Usage
Just add the following to your `Cargo.toml`:

```toml
[build-dependencies]
coin-build-tools = "0.2"
```

## Configuration

The package build from the source and link statically by default. It also provide the following environment variables to allow users to link to system library customly:

* `CARGO_${LIB_NAME}_STATIC` to link to CoinUtils statically;
* `CARGO_${LIB_NAME}_SYSTEM` to link to CoinUtils system library;

Set the environment variable to `1` to enable the feature. For example, to link to system library dynamically, set `CARGO_${LIB_NAME}_SYSTEM` to `1`; to link to system library statically, set both `CARGO_${LIB_NAME}_SYSTEM` and `CARGO_${LIB_NAME}_STATIC` to `1`.

## Windows and vcpkg

On Windows, if `${LIB_NAME}_SYSTEM` is set to `1`, `osi-src` will use 
[vcpkg] to find Osi. Before building, you must have the correct Osi 
installed for your target triplet and kind of linking. For instance,
to link dynamically for the `x86_64-pc-windows-msvc` toolchain, install
 `osi` for the `x64-windows` triplet:

```sh
vcpkg install osi --triplet x64-windows
```

To link Osi statically, install `osi` for the `x64-windows-static-md` triplet:

```sh
vcpkg install osi --triplet x64-windows-static-md
```

To link Osi and C Runtime (CRT) statically, install `osi` for the `x64-windows-static` triplet:

```sh
vcpkg install osi --triplet x64-windows-static
```

and build with `+crt-static` option

```
RUSTFLAGS='-C target-feature=+crt-static' cargo build --target x86_64-pc-windows-msvc
```

Please see the ["Static and dynamic C runtimes" in The Rust reference](https://doc.rust-lang.org/reference/linkage.html#static-and-dynamic-c-runtimes) for detail.
